国产精品久久久aaaa,日日干夜夜操天天插,亚洲乱熟女香蕉一区二区三区少妇,99精品国产高清一区二区三区,国产成人精品一区二区色戒,久久久国产精品成人免费,亚洲精品毛片久久久久,99久久婷婷国产综合精品电影,国产一区二区三区任你鲁

0
  • 聊天消息
  • 系統消息
  • 評論與回復
登錄后你可以
  • 下載海量資料
  • 學習在線課程
  • 觀看技術視頻
  • 寫文章/發帖/加入社區
會員中心
創作中心

完善資料讓更多小伙伴認識你,還能領取20積分哦,立即完善>

3天內不再提示

2018必玩的開發板,到底有何過人之處

h1654155971.7688 ? 來源:未知 ? 作者:李倩 ? 2018-03-26 09:01 ? 次閱讀
加入交流群
微信小助手二維碼

掃碼添加小助手

加入工程師交流群

PocketBeagle是《Methods》評選出的2018最值得關注的開發工具之一,特色是搭載了OCTAVO將AM3358和PMIC等大量外圍電路集成到一起的SIP。體積變小,不過絡連接功能及BLE的缺失。通過CAPS來進行添加則會增加了成本,低價開發板也變成了一句空話!不過話說回來,靈活性確實增強了,喜歡藍牙的可以添加藍牙模塊,喜歡用WIFI的用戶可以自己選擇WIFI模塊,各取所需! 繼續使用功能更完善的BBB,還是選擇體積與價格更有優勢的PocketBeagle,你會怎么選?

先扯點閑話,不久前看到MOUSER的電子雜志《Methods》上推薦2018年最值得關注的幾個產品,如下

三星的Artik據說是全家桶,該有的都有;Intel的神經計算棒乘著人工智能的東風,自然也值得關注;Bluetooth 5也是個好東西;只是最后一個產品居然是來自beagleboard.org的一款開發板,有點意外。

提到beaglebone.org,大家第一想到的大概是BBB,BBB的全稱是BeagleBone Black,國內俗稱狗板,正是來自beaglebone.org的產品,現在PocketBeagle又來了,能否超越曾經的經典BBB,讓我們一起來看看這個被Mouser標注為2018必玩的開發板,到底有何過人之處。

PocketBeagle給人的第一印象就是小巧,到底有多小,官方給出的尺寸是56mm x 35mm,重量僅10g。產品包裝使用的的透明的卡套式包裝。

內附一張快速用戶指南,標明了產品的主要特性及快速開始的URL地址。從快速指南上可以看到,官方將PocketBeagle的角色定位在3D打印機、機器人及游戲機開發領域。

PocketBeagle確實夠緊湊,只是仔細看,忍不住有點疑惑,外圍電路競如此簡單!秘密都藏在中間的封裝器件里,這里說的是封裝,而不是CPU

單從外觀看,值得仔細描述的地方真不多,除了MicroSD卡接口,一個USB接口,其余的就是引出的GPIO焊盤了。

和前輩BBB放在一起合個影,顯然,PocketBeagle少了很多東西,DRAM在哪里, PMIC哪去了?在解決這個問題之前,仔細看看PocketBeagle上能看到哪些組件。

秘密都藏在OSD3358-SM這個SIP里面。SIP(System In a Package系統級封裝)是將多種功能芯片,包括處理器、存儲器等功能芯片集成在一個封裝內,從而實現一個基本完整的功能。與SoC(System On a Chip系統級芯片)相對應。不同的是系統級封裝是采用不同芯片進行并排或疊加的封裝方式,而SOC則是高度集成的芯片產品。

這款來自OCTAVO System的OSD3358-SM模塊,在有限的尺寸里集成了TI的AM3358處理器、DDR3存儲器、TPS65217C PMIC管理及TL5209 LDO,另外還有4KB的EEPROM

這也就是為什么我們在PocketBeagle找不到DDR等器件的原因了,都集成到模塊里了。這樣的好處,一是在進行產品設計時,硬件設計電路更簡單,進一步提高了可靠性;其次,可以大幅度減少PCB的尺寸,有利于減少產品的體積。另外與BBB相比,PocketBeagle沒有包含EMMC存儲器,操作系統等軟件資源都存儲在SD卡上,所以要體驗PocketBeagle,最好還得準備一個4GB以上的SD存儲卡。

從beaglebone.org下載最新的DEBIAN操作系統,下載的系統映像是.XZ壓縮格式,先用7ZIP將其解壓

解壓后得到的.IMG格式,需要寫入到SD卡上,官方推薦使用ETCHER工具來將其寫入到SD卡

如果想獲得更好的存儲性能,建議使用CLASS 10規格以上的SD卡。

PocketBeagle板載的USB接口還可以兼任供電器的角色,也可以使用P1/P2提供的5V/VIN等接口來給開發板供電,但更多情況下我們使用的還是USB接口來供電。

PocketBeagle沒有提供HDMI/VGA接口,所以暫時只能用HEADLESS模式來訪問開發板了。另外PocketBeagle也沒有提供以太網和無線接口,也沒有藍牙通信模塊,看上去似乎有點頭疼。不過和BBB一樣,可以通過USB存儲系統及USB虛擬網絡來和PocketBeagle進行通信。

PocketBeagle通過USB接口與PC連接并上電后,PC端會看到一個存儲磁盤

可以通過WEB方式來進行軟件開發,雙擊該磁盤里的START.HTML文件,瀏覽器里就可以看到如何使用PocketBeagle的詳細教程,如下

這里的步驟介紹得相當詳細,讓咱們化繁為簡,簡單點說,就是直接在瀏覽器里打開192.168.7.2這個地址,然后就能通過WEB方式來對PocketBeagle進行編程及控制。

PocketBeagle提供幾個開發IDE,如上圖所示,他們分別是Node-RED及Cloud9 IDE,這些都是有名的基于WEB方式開發的IDE,其中Node-RED使用的是圖形開發模式,類似Scratch的開發模式,開發者只需要簡單的拖放組件到開發窗口,按特定的邏輯進行組織這些組件,就可以完成開發過程。Cloud9則是一個完整的IDE,適合更喜歡直接碼代碼的開發者。

beaglebone.org為Beagle系列開發板提供了BoneScript支持,使用Node.js做為開發語言,開發者只需要調用BoneScript提供的API接口就可以直接操作GPIO/I2C等外部接口,API接口命名方式與Arduino基本一致,例如pinMode(), digitalWrite()等函數,熟悉Arduino的用戶可以立即上手。

聯機文檔提供了非常的API參考,另外也提供了大量DEMO代碼,這些代碼包括.JS及.INO格式的代碼,供用戶參考

點擊上方綠色的Run按鈕,即可將代碼編譯并部署到開發板。

這樣來看,完全是將PocketBeagle當成一個Arduino來用了,只不過系統的底層是基于Linux的,有更完善的軟件支持,對于一般的電子愛好者也降低了入門的門檻。

喜歡嵌入式Linux的讀者也許不樂意了,說好的Linux了,怎么體驗?

Linux愛好者都有一個逃不開的坎,那就是命令行!PocketBeagle在啟動后,會通過USB虛擬的網絡接口將PocketBeagle與PC組成一個簡單的局域網,PocketBeagle本身的IP地址固定為192.168.7.2,而PC端的IP地址則為192.168.7.1,二者可以直接進行通信。

圖中以太網2就是虛擬的USB網絡接口

使用putty等SSH軟件就可以來連接到PocketBeagle,過一過命令行的癮!

這是使用putty連接到PocketBeagle的初始加密信息,點擊“是”進入下一步

默認的用戶名及口令分別為debian/temppwd,登錄成功后看到熟悉的命令行了,先看看網絡配置情況,如下

usb0接口的IP地址為192.168.7.2,只是仔細看,會發現這個IP地址有點怪,其中子網掩碼值為255.255.255.252,而廣播地址則為192.168.7.3。

要簡釋這個問題,需要懂一點子網劃分的基礎知識。根據子網掩碼值255.255.255.252,我們得知這是一個包括64個子網的劃分方案,每個子網最多包括2臺主機,在192.168.7.0/30這個子網段內,有效的IP地址為192.168.7.1及192.168.7.2,而192.168.7.0及192.168.7.3則分別代表網絡地址及廣播地址。

接下來準備更新一下系統,按官方的說法,是直接下載最新的系統鏡像,然后寫入到SD卡中完成系統更新,現在既然有了網絡,當然就不需要如此麻煩了。

不過還得配置一下網絡,默認的網絡有倆個問題,一是沒有配置默認網關,二是沒有指定DNS解析。所以先要在PocketBeagle修改并配置這倆選項,如圖

這是默認的路由,沒有默認網關,需要添加默認網關及DNS解析后就可以了。

下面是添加相關配置后更新系統的畫面

接下來就可以把PocketBeagle當作一般的Linux嵌入式開發板用了。

這樣子雖然也可以用,但是PocketBeagle的配置文件resolv.conf的真實位置位于/run目錄下,每次開機都會重新生成,所以每次都需要重新配置一下,否則會找不到DNS解析相關的信息,解決的辦法是寫一個簡單的腳本文件,每次需要聯網之前先運行該腳本文件重新配置一下即可。

總結來說,PocketBeagle的特色在于保持了TI AM3358高性能的同時,得益于SIP封裝技術,極大的減少了模塊體積,同時SIP封裝集成了大量外圍電路如PMIC等,也極大的簡化了產品的設計,降低了技術門檻。

不過由于尺寸的減少,開發板集成的網絡連接功能及BLE的缺失,這些功能固然可以通過CAPS來進行添加,但是也增加了成本,低價開發板也變成了一句空話!不過話說回來,靈活性確實增強了,喜歡藍牙的可以添加藍牙模塊,喜歡用WIFI的用戶可以自己選擇WIFI模塊,各取所需!

繼續使用功能更完善的BBB,還是選擇體積與價格更有優勢的PocketBeagle,你會怎么選?

聲明:本文內容及配圖由入駐作者撰寫或者入駐合作網站授權轉載。文章觀點僅代表作者本人,不代表電子發燒友網立場。文章及其配圖僅供工程師學習之用,如有內容侵權或者其他違規問題,請聯系本站處理。 舉報投訴
  • 開發板
    +關注

    關注

    26

    文章

    6289

    瀏覽量

    118044
  • wifi模塊
    +關注

    關注

    60

    文章

    393

    瀏覽量

    77183

原文標題:不能再小了,2018最值得關注的開發板來了

文章出處:【微信號:weixin21ic,微信公眾號:21ic電子網】歡迎添加關注!文章轉載請注明出處。

收藏 人收藏
加入交流群
微信小助手二維碼

掃碼添加小助手

加入工程師交流群

    評論

    相關推薦
    熱點推薦

    AGV激光導航到底有什么過人之處

    激光導航AGV以±10毫米的精準定位、無需地面輔助的靈活部署,以及卓越的環境適應力,成為智能制造時代的高效搬運解決方案,顯著提升生產柔性與長期經濟效益。
    的頭像 發表于 03-04 16:54 ?259次閱讀
    AGV激光導航<b class='flag-5'>到底有</b>什么<b class='flag-5'>過人之處</b>?

    深入剖析DA14695MOD:一款強大的SmartBond藍牙低功耗模塊

    。Renesas的DA14695MOD SmartBond藍牙LE 5.2模塊,憑借其卓越的性能和豐富的功能,為開發者提供了一個理想的解決方案。今天,我們就來深入剖析這款模塊,看看它到底有哪些過人之處。 文件下載
    的頭像 發表于 12-29 13:55 ?321次閱讀

    探索MCIMX93-QSB開發板:開啟嵌入式開發新征程

    的MCIMX93-QSB開發板,看看它都有哪些獨特之處。 文件下載: NXP Semiconductors MCIMX93-QSB開發板.pdf 一、MCIMX93-QSB開發板概述
    的頭像 發表于 12-24 14:55 ?749次閱讀

    工程師入!288 元解鎖賽靈思開發板

    做項目、練技術、備賽事卻找不到高性價比開發板?合眾恒躍重磅福利——賽靈思ZYNQ系列開發板限時特惠,HZ-XC-7Z010-SP_EVM寵粉價僅需288元!
    的頭像 發表于 12-17 17:48 ?757次閱讀
    工程師<b class='flag-5'>必</b>入!288 元解鎖賽靈思<b class='flag-5'>開發板</b>

    自動駕駛中毫米波雷達到底有作用?

    毫米波雷達、超聲波雷達等感知硬件,更像是一個配角,成為自動駕駛技術實現的輔助硬件。那在自動駕駛中毫米波雷達到底有作用?
    的頭像 發表于 12-10 17:07 ?1865次閱讀
    自動駕駛中毫米波雷達<b class='flag-5'>到底有</b><b class='flag-5'>何</b>作用?

    ESP32-P4全功能開發板和ESP32-P4-TINY開發板該怎么選?看這篇就夠了!

    啟明云端基于樂鑫科技ESP32-P4芯片設計了多款開發板,這些開發板什么區別?基于應用場景如何選擇?本期,我們聚焦兩款代表性產品:WT99P4C5-S1開發板與WT9932P4-TI
    的頭像 發表于 12-09 18:02 ?888次閱讀
    ESP32-P4全功能<b class='flag-5'>開發板</b>和ESP32-P4-TINY<b class='flag-5'>開發板</b>該怎么選?看這篇就夠了!

    這款嵌入式工控機,它到底牛在哪?

    “批量部署”的優選,既能滿足復雜場景需求,又能大幅降低開發門檻,讓產品應用落地更高效。 ? 現在,讓我們一起來看下,它到底有過人之處? ▍常用接口“全配齊”
    的頭像 發表于 12-03 11:11 ?376次閱讀
    這款嵌入式工控機,它<b class='flag-5'>到底</b>牛在哪?

    線路鍍金與沉金區別?

    在電子制造的世界里,線路就像是一座城市的交通網絡,而鍍金和沉金則是為這座“交通網絡”進行升級的重要手段。那么,線路鍍金與沉金到底有區別呢?今天咱們就來一探究竟。 定義和原理上的差
    的頭像 發表于 09-30 11:53 ?657次閱讀

    電磁干擾“江湖三兄弟”:EMC、EMI、EMS 到底有啥區別?

    電磁干擾“江湖三兄弟”:EMC、EMI、EMS 到底有啥區別?
    的頭像 發表于 08-20 15:16 ?2677次閱讀
    電磁干擾“江湖三兄弟”:EMC、EMI、EMS <b class='flag-5'>到底有</b>啥區別?

    漫畫科普 | 功率放大器到底有哪些應用?帶你解鎖功放經典應用場景!(一)

    漫畫科普 | 功率放大器到底有哪些應用?帶你解鎖功放經典應用場景!(一)
    的頭像 發表于 06-20 20:00 ?980次閱讀
    漫畫科普 | 功率放大器<b class='flag-5'>到底有</b>哪些應用?帶你解鎖功放經典應用場景!(一)

    ARM,NPU,FPGA三種核心的開發板 — 米爾安路飛龍派開發板

    最近我發現一個有趣的開發板。這個開發板集合了ARM核心,NPU核心甚至還有FPGA核心。它就是米爾新出的YM90X開發板。它基于安路科技所打造的芯片上海安路信息科技于2021年在上交所科創
    的頭像 發表于 06-13 08:03 ?1708次閱讀
    <b class='flag-5'>有</b>ARM,NPU,FPGA三種核心的<b class='flag-5'>開發板</b> — 米爾安路飛龍派<b class='flag-5'>開發板</b>

    【新品】遠距離圖傳數傳模塊開發板、藍牙模塊開發板、無線模塊開發板

    新品上市圖傳數傳模塊開發板藍牙模塊開發板國產無線模塊開發板部分型號參與送樣文末了解詳情↓↓↓EWT611-900NW20S遠距離圖傳數傳模塊開發板EWT611-900NW20S是一款入
    的頭像 發表于 06-12 19:33 ?1142次閱讀
    【新品】遠距離圖傳數傳模塊<b class='flag-5'>開發板</b>、藍牙模塊<b class='flag-5'>開發板</b>、無線模塊<b class='flag-5'>開發板</b>

    藍牙音頻串口透傳開發板音頻接收方案

    音頻模塊串口開發板,看看它究竟有過人之處。一、外觀設計:簡約而不簡單初見ANS-DB003M,其簡約的設計風格便給人留下了深刻印象。開發板布局合理,接口標識清晰,
    的頭像 發表于 06-06 16:48 ?991次閱讀
    藍牙音頻串口透傳<b class='flag-5'>開發板</b>音頻接收方案

    第二章 開發板與芯片介紹 詳解W55MH32芯片及開發板

    本章介紹了W55MH32芯片及開發板。該芯片采用Cortex-M3內核,主頻216MHz,集成以太網功能,L和Q兩種型號。配套開發板L-EVB功能豐富、Q-EVB為最小系統,均含仿
    的頭像 發表于 05-26 09:19 ?1431次閱讀
    第二章 <b class='flag-5'>開發板</b>與芯片介紹  詳解W55MH32芯片及<b class='flag-5'>開發板</b>

    實測 PTR54LS05低功耗到底有多低

    實測 PTR54LS05低功耗到底有多低?
    發表于 04-27 10:57